WebFeb 26, 2016 · Room Temperature Vulcanization (RTV) Silicone is a kind of silicone rubber that is generally supplied as a one-part system with a wide viscosity range. It’s comprised … WebAs DOWSIL™ 732 RTV Adhesive Sealant cures by reaction with moisture in air, keep the container tightly sealed when not in use. A plug of used material may form in the tip of a … Webadhesive/sealant will be tack-free in less than 45 minutes. Cure Time After skin formation, cure continues inward from the surface. In 24 hours (at room temperature and 50% relative humidity) DOWSIL™ 732 RTV Adhesive Sealant will cure to a depth of about 3 mm. WebFeb 15, 2024 · RTV stands for room temperature vulcanizing. RTV silicone begins to cure immediately upon being exposed to air, as opposed to the curing agents in water-based sealants (for example, latex). It lends itself well to working as a sealer because it is water … The most commonly used RTV silicones are acetoxy cure silicone and neutral cure …
